When Mailtrap wins

  • Dev teams that want one vendor for both email testing and production sending
  • SaaS startups under 100k/month Email API volume who can ride the Basic tier ramp
  • Teams that need a dedicated IP without paying for SendGrid Pro or higher

Where Mailtrap is the wrong fit

  • Marketing-only teams (use Mailchimp or Kit)
  • Buyers who want flat predictable per-tier pricing (Postmark is more predictable)
  • Enterprises needing voice or SMS in the same platform (use Twilio or SendGrid)

When Tally wins

  • Bootstrappers and indie makers who want a free Typeform alternative with no response caps
  • Teams already in Notion or Airtable wanting a matching form aesthetic
  • Small teams who can't justify $79+/mo on Typeform Plus

Where Tally is the wrong fit

  • Enterprises requiring SSO/SAML or HIPAA (Typeform Enterprise covers those)
  • Brands needing the polished one-question-at-a-time conversational UX that is Typeform's signature
  • Teams that need video questions (Typeform Growth Pro)
